BEITBRIDGE Municipality plans to meet all ratepayers in an initiative to establish reasons behind non compliance with rates and other service charges.
Town clerk Loud Ramakgapola said the initiative to start this week hopes to have an interaction with over 600 individuals from different sections including residential, commercial, industrial, open spaces, to name a few and establish reasons of defaulting.
“We want to find a way forward and find common ground as to why there is little compliance, we will go ward by ward and visit every category of ratepayers in this initiative,” he said.
Beitbridge is throttled with huge ratepayer debt and is struggling to provide minimum service.
Some residents however blame ratepayers behaviour on municipality inefficiency with almost all new suburbs without water or sewer services.
People in ese areas have spent thousands on boreholes and sceptic tanks which could have been channelled to Municipality coffers.
